## Releases

SheetFunnel ships monthly. Tag from main, let the Quarrel CI pipeline build and publish the wizard bundle to the artifact shelf. Do not hand-build releases. Changelog entries go in RELEASES.md before tagging, no exceptions. All bundles are signed; consumers reject unsigned imports at install time. Check your download before distributing it to support staff. Verify each bundle against the team's public signing key below.

signing key of bagap-yawep = bky13_TbfT6ZMUoGJo2

Handover for the weekly eng sync: I'm transferring ownership of Duskrunner, our nightly backfill scheduler, to Priya. Current state: all jobs healthy except the ledger-reconciliation backfill, which retries once nightly due to a slow upstream from the Kestwick warehouse. Retry logic, window sizing, and concurrency caps were all tuned carefully last quarter — please don't change them without a load test. For full transparency at the sync, the production instance runs with these configuration values.

settings of hawep-kadug:
RALAEL_HOST=ralael.tolvaqlabs.internal
RALAEL_PORT=9000

Runbook fragment — Payrill retry hardening

Quick recap for the sync: every payment retry on Payrill now requires an idempotency key derived from the order UUID plus attempt window. No more duplicate charges like the Marlow's incident. Rollout goes canary first, then full fleet after 24h of clean ledgers. If reconciliation drifts, roll back via the usual toggle. Before promoting artifacts, verify they're signed with the release key below.

release key, hadug-kawef: bky13_mPGeFZeR1GZ1G

14:22 — The Lanternway driver-assignment heuristic began preferring stale location pings after the cache TTL change, routing jobs to drivers who had gone offline. Dispatch noticed climbing unassigned counts within eight minutes. We rolled back the TTL config and reassignments recovered by 14:41. The rollback deploy that restored service is identified by the token below.

build token for kagaf-hahof: htk14_9d3d4d26d7d8de